What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Dyersville, Iowa?
In Dyersville, Iowa,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,000, depending on the level of care, room type, and amenities. This is generally lower than the national average, making Dyersville an affordable option for seniors in Eastern Iowa. It's best to contact local facilities directly for specific pricing and any available financial assistance programs.

How does Iowa regulate assisted living facilities, and what should I look for in Dyersville?
Assisted living facilities in Iowa, including those in Dyersville, are regulated by the Iowa Department of Inspections and Appeals. They must meet standards for safety, staffing, and care. When evaluating a facility in Dyersville, check for recent inspection reports, verify staff credentials, and ensure the facility offers personalized care plans. Local facilities often emphasize a home-like atmosphere, consistent with Iowa's regulatory focus on resident dignity and quality of life.
